Spain World Cup Squad Update: Chelsea's Del Horno Out, Getafe's Mariano Pernia ReplacesSubmitted by Scott Harkness on Thu, 08/06/2006 - 04:14.
Updated Spain squad for World Cup Finals Germany 2006: Spain's La Furia Roja have lost Chelsea's Asier del Horno to injury, with Getafe's Mariano Pernia replacing him. Del Horno damaged the area around his Achilles tendon in training in late May, and Spain's national team doctor Genaro Borras said the player would be out of action for around three weeks, which ruled him out of the World Cup Finals.
